Product details

Overview

AD8062ARMZ-R7 from Analog Devices is a dual, rail-to-rail output voltage feedback operational amplifier optimized for high-speed, low-power, single-supply applications. It delivers 300 MHz −3 dB bandwidth (G = 1, VS = 3 V), 650 V/µs slew rate, and 8.5 nV/√Hz input voltage noise, enabling precision video buffering, ADC driving, and RGB amplification in professional cameras and portable imaging systems.

For engineers reviewing the AD8062ARMZ-R7 datasheet, AD8062ARMZ-R7 pinout, AD8062ARMZ-R7 application, or AD8062ARMZ-R7 equivalent, key selection criteria include its 35 ns settling time to 0.1%, differential gain error of 0.01% (NTSC, RL = 150 Ω), rail-to-rail output swing down to 0.1 V above −VS and up to 4.86 V below +VS (RL = 2 kΩ), and 6.8 mA per amplifier quiescent current at 5 V.

Technical Context

The AD8062ARMZ-R7 employs a voltage-feedback architecture with a high-slew-rate input stage capable of sensing signals 200 mV below the negative rail, and a rail-to-rail common-emitter output stage delivering ±30 mV headroom into light loads. Its input common-mode range extends from −0.2 V to +3.2 V at VS = 5 V, supporting true single-supply operation down to 2.7 V.

It maintains 0.1 dB gain flatness to 30 MHz into 150 Ω, achieves −90 dBc crosstalk between outputs at 5 MHz, and recovers from overload in 35 ns - critical for multiplexed video and fast-settling data acquisition paths where signal integrity across channels and timing margins are tightly constrained.

Key Specifications

Parameter Value and Actual Design Meaning
−3 dB Bandwidth 300 MHz at G = 1, VS = 3 V - supports full HD video baseband and clock buffer applications without external compensation.
Slew Rate 650 V/µs at G = 1, RL = 2 kΩ - enables clean 1 V step response with <35 ns 0.1% settling, suitable for fast DAC output conditioning.
Input Voltage Noise 8.5 nV/√Hz at 100 kHz - preserves SNR in photodiode preamp and low-level sensor signal chains.
Differential Gain Error 0.01% at G = 2, RL = 150 Ω - meets broadcast-grade NTSC video fidelity requirements without post-correction.
Quiescent Current 6.8 mA per amplifier at VS = 5 V - balances speed and power for battery-constrained handheld imaging devices.
Output Swing 0.1 V to 4.86 V (RL = 2 kΩ) - delivers full dynamic range on 5 V single supply, eliminating level-shifting circuitry.
Supply Range 2.7 V to 8 V - interoperable with Li-ion, 3.3 V logic, and industrial 5 V rails without regulator overhead.

Pinout & Package

AD8062ARMZ-R7 is housed in an 8-lead SOIC (R) package (JEDEC MS-012AA), 4.9 mm × 3.9 mm × 1.75 mm, with standard gull-wing leads and exposed pad not connected internally.

Pin Circuit Role Design Meaning
1 VOUT1 Output of Amplifier 1 - drives loads up to 50 mA with rail-to-rail swing; requires local 0.1 µF bypass to −VS.
2 −IN1 Inverting input of Amplifier 1 - high-impedance (13 MΩ), low-capacitance (1 pF) node; sensitive to PCB parasitics.
3 +IN1 Non-inverting input of Amplifier 1 - shares same DC and AC specs as −IN1; used for unity-gain buffers and active filters.
4 −VS Negative supply rail - connects to ground in single-supply mode; must be low-impedance with dedicated plane or trace.
5 +VS Positive supply rail - accepts 2.7 V to 8 V; requires 0.1 µF ceramic + 10 µF tantalum decoupling adjacent to pin.
6 VOUT2 Output of Amplifier 2 - electrically isolated from VOUT1; crosstalk ≤ −90 dBc at 5 MHz ensures channel independence.
7 −IN2 Inverting input of Amplifier 2 - identical specs to −IN1; routing symmetry critical for matched dual-channel performance.
8 +IN2 Non-inverting input of Amplifier 2 - independent bias path; no internal connection to +IN1 or other pins.

Key Features

Feature Design Value
Rail-to-rail output swing Delivers 0.1 V to 4.86 V output on 5 V supply (RL = 2 kΩ), preserving full ADC input range without clamping diodes.
300 MHz bandwidth at 3 V Enables direct buffering of 720p/1080p video clocks and HDMI auxiliary signals without gain peaking or stability compromises.
35 ns 0.1% settling time Supports >20 MSPS sampling in pipeline ADC front-ends where aperture uncertainty must remain <1 LSB at 12-bit resolution.
0.01% differential gain error Meets SMPTE RP-168 and ITU-R BT.601 video linearity specs for broadcast camera signal chains without calibration.
6.8 mA per amplifier supply current Reduces thermal load in dense PCB layouts; allows dual-channel operation within 13.6 mA total at 5 V, easing LDO selection.
−90 dBc output-to-output crosstalk Prevents ghosting or color bleed in RGB or YUV triple-amplifier configurations used in professional monitors and projectors.

Applications

Professional Video Signal Conditioning High-Speed ADC Driver

Use Scenario: Driving 150 Ω coaxial cable inputs of SDI receivers or analog video digitizers in broadcast cameras.

IC Role / Device Role / Timing Role: Dual-channel video buffer with gain = 2, compensating for cable loss while maintaining NTSC/PAL timing integrity.

Use Value: 0.01% differential gain and 0.04° phase error eliminate need for external video correction ICs, reducing BOM count and board area.

Use Scenario: Buffering outputs of 12-bit, 25 MSPS SAR ADCs in portable test equipment where input drive capability and settling are critical.

IC Role / Device Role / Timing Role: Unity-gain follower isolating ADC input from source impedance variations and ensuring <35 ns acquisition window closure.

Use Value: 35 ns 0.1% settling time guarantees full-scale accuracy at maximum sample rate, avoiding missing codes or integral nonlinearity drift.

RGB Video Amplification Photodiode Transimpedance Preamp

Use Scenario: Amplifying red, green, and blue analog video signals in digital projectors and medical endoscopes requiring precise color fidelity.

IC Role / Device Role / Timing Role: Triple-amplifier configuration (using two AD8062ARMZ-R7s plus one AD8061) with matched gain and phase across all three channels.

Use Value: −90 dBc inter-channel crosstalk prevents color contamination; 30 MHz 0.1 dB flatness ensures uniform gamma response across visible spectrum.

Use Scenario: Converting low-current photodiode output (nA–µA range) into robust voltage signals for optical smoke detectors and pulse oximeters.

IC Role / Device Role / Timing Role: Transimpedance amplifier with 1 MΩ feedback resistor, leveraging low input bias current (3.5 µA typ) and 8.5 nV/√Hz noise floor.

Use Value: Input-referred noise of 8.5 nV/√Hz enables detection of sub-100 nA photocurrents at 1 kHz bandwidth without cooling or chopper stabilization.

Equivalent & Alternatives

The following parts are listed as comparable options for similar high-speed op amp applications.

Alternative Part Technical Difference Application Difference Selection Advice
LMH6629MA/NOPB Higher bandwidth (1.5 GHz), higher supply current (12.5 mA/amplifier), no rail-to-rail output (clips ~1.2 V from rails). Better suited for RF IF amplification or ultra-high-speed oscilloscope front-ends where output swing is less critical than bandwidth. Select LMH6629MA/NOPB only when >1 GHz small-signal bandwidth is required and rail-to-rail output is unnecessary.
ADA4897-2ARZ Lower noise (1.1 nV/√Hz), lower distortion (−90 dBc THD), but narrower bandwidth (210 MHz) and higher cost. Preferred for precision instrumentation and audio line drivers where SNR dominates over raw speed. Choose ADA4897-2ARZ when system-level SNR >90 dB is mandatory and 210 MHz bandwidth suffices for signal chain requirements.

Compared with LMH6629MA/NOPB and ADA4897-2ARZ, AD8062ARMZ-R7 uniquely balances 300 MHz bandwidth, rail-to-rail output, 6.8 mA power, and 0.01% video linearity - making it the optimal choice for cost-sensitive, space-constrained imaging and video infrastructure where all four attributes are simultaneously required.

FAQ

What is the maximum operating supply voltage for AD8062ARMZ-R7?

The AD8062ARMZ-R7 has an absolute maximum supply voltage rating of 8 V. Operation beyond this risks permanent damage. For reliable long-term use, Analog Devices specifies a recommended operating range of 2.7 V to 8 V, with full performance guaranteed across that span. At 8 V, quiescent current rises to 9.5 mA per amplifier, and thermal derating must be observed per Figure 6 in the Rev. J datasheet.

Does AD8062ARMZ-R7 support true rail-to-rail input operation?

No, AD8062ARMZ-R7 does not support rail-to-rail input. Its input common-mode voltage range is −0.2 V to +3.2 V at VS = 5 V - meaning it accepts signals 200 mV below ground but only up to 1.8 V below +VS. The input stage is optimized for single-supply use with ground-referenced sources, not full rail spanning. For true rail-to-rail input, consider the AD8021 or ADA4898-1 families.

Can AD8062ARMZ-R7 drive a 150 Ω video load with gain = 2 while meeting broadcast specifications?

Yes. AD8062ARMZ-R7 delivers 0.01% differential gain error and 0.04° differential phase error into 150 Ω at G = 2 and VS = 5 V - fully compliant with SMPTE RP-168 and ITU-R BT.601 broadcast video standards. Its 30 MHz 0.1 dB flatness and −90 dBc crosstalk ensure color fidelity and channel isolation required in RGB and YUV systems.

What is the typical output current capability of AD8062ARMZ-R7?

AD8062ARMZ-R7 delivers up to 50 mA of continuous output current per amplifier, with guaranteed minimum of 25 mA across temperature and supply conditions. This supports direct driving of terminated video lines, ADC reference buffers, and moderate-capacitance loads (up to 300 pF with RS = 4.7 Ω in G = 2 configuration), as verified in Tables 1–3 and Figure 7 of the Rev. J datasheet.

Is AD8062ARMZ-R7 pin-compatible with other members of the AD806x family?

AD8062ARMZ-R7 (dual) is pin-compatible with AD8061ARMZ (single) in the same 8-lead SOIC package - sharing identical pin 1–4 and 5–8 assignments. However, it is not pin-compatible with AD8063ARMZ (dual with disable) or any SOT-23 variants (AD8061ART, AD8063ART). Board reuse is possible only between AD8061ARMZ and AD8062ARMZ footprints.
